Using the distributive law, multiply each term of one polynomial by the other term in the different polynomial. The exponent law states that if the multiplication of two monomials takes place, then the base is multiplied and the exponents are added. With multiplying, you just have to be very careful that you add exponents of like bases for each set of terms that you are multiplying.

Multiplying exponents with negative powers follow the same set of rules as multiplying exponents positive powers. For more about multiplying terms, read multiply and divide variables with exponents. A polynomial can be made up of variables (such as x and y), constants (such as 3, 5, and 11), and exponents (such as the 2 in x 2.) in 2x + 4, 4 is the constant and 2 is the coefficient of x.
